✅ Submit NF 902 every month within 7 days of month-end. ✅ Stock value should be , whichever is lower. ✅ Do not include obsolete / slow-moving stock in pledged stock. ✅ Always keep a signed copy (physical or digitally signed) for bank audit. ✅ If drawing power reduces due to stock shortage, repay excess immediately to avoid penal interest.

Bold header with branch address, loan a/c number, and statement period. Row 7: Column headers – Sl No, Item Description, HSN Code, UOM, Qty, Rate, Value, Stock Type, Aging (Days), Remarks . Rows 8-25: Inventory data with alternating row colors for readability. Row 26: TOTAL : =SUM(Value_Range) . Row 28: Less: Obsolete/Stock > 90 days : manually entered or extracted via SUMIF . Row 29: Eligible Stock Value : formula. Row 30: Margin @ 25% : =Eligible*0.25 . Row 31: Drawing Power : =Eligible - Margin . Row 33-40: Declarations – "We hereby certify that the stock is insured...", signature line, date, place. Row 41: Prepared by and Checked by with date stamps.
